Fergus Printing Co, 1890-01-01. Hardcover. Acceptable. 1890 First edition, Ex-library, Fergus Printing Co. (Chicago), xxv, 521 pp. ,6 x 9 inches tall x 3 inches thick. Heavy black cloth hardbound, paper label to spine, fore and bottom page edges untrimmed, many full-page portraits with tissue guards. All the usual library treatments, including call numbers and removed label on spine. Tape repairs to both interior hinges, with some shakiness to spine, but all holds firm. Covers rubbed, bumped, chipped, soiled and edgeworn. Otherwise, a very good first edition copy of this important history of Chicago.~PP~
